5 Essential Considerations Before Purchasing an Air Conditioner in Austin, TX
From the scorching heat of Texas summers to the harrowing thunderstorms and chilly winters, central Texans must be prepared for any weather condition. That means having a reliable and efficient air conditioner is essential to keep homes comfortable. Austin, TX is no exception, which is why Austinites need to consider five essential factors before committing to any air conditioning repair, installation, or replacement.
It's important to understand your home's thermal profile and environment. The size of your home, the amount of insulation, shaded windows, the direction of the sun, the placement of vents, and other thermal characteristics should all be taken into account. Understanding your property size, location, vent placement, and its energy efficiency requirements, will enable you to make the best decision when it comes to purchasing an air conditioning unit.
The next factor to consider is how much you're willing to spend on installation and repair. Prices can vary wildly depending on the brand, type, and size of the air conditioning unit. Professional installation costs are significantly higher than handling the installation yourself, but the added cost may be well worth the peace of mind and quality assurance. While cost is an essential consideration for any purchase, Austinites must also make sure their selected air conditioning unit passes building codes, regulations, and warranty guidelines.
Considering the local humidity and temperature in Austin, the HVAC contractor's selection of the appropriate unit must also factor into the decision. Choosing the wrong air conditioning repair or installation can not only increase energy costs but can also lead to added maintenance and future repair costs. Whether you need a standard or hybrid air conditioning unit, an experienced contractor can provide the best advice and installation options tailored to your specific property.
Energy-efficiency ratings should also be taken into account to ensure the air conditioning unit meets your environmental and financial expectations. Also consider the type of refrigerant used. Traditional refrigerants have a global warming impact and limited availability. The latest refrigerants use more eco-friendly materials and have a longer life expectancy.
Finally, inspecting the quality and size of the air conditioning unit is also key to ensure it meets your requirements. It should be installed properly and meet the specifications provided by the manufacturer. Any necessary ductwork repairs, cleaning, or any additional insulation should also be taken care of ahead of time.
Finding a reliable air conditioning contractor in Austin, TX, who is licensed and insured is essential. Most firms should have a portfolio of clients to showcase their particular niche or expertise.
